About EasyBiz
Accessing local government services using the internet has grown by 150 per cent since 2004. This is the fastest rate of growth for any of the three levels of government over that time.

Recognising the importance of the internet for businesses transactions with government to reduce the overall time and cost to business, the Federal Government funded the EasyBiz project. Online forms for 18, high volume transactions in the areas of planning, building, and environmental health have been developed and councils are being supported with hands on assistance to integrate these with back end systems.

The Victorian Government has provided funding to extend the project and roll out the forms to all councils by 2009.

What is EasyBiz
EasyBiz offers businesses a consistent experience through one common form across councils for 18 transactions that clearly identify the requirements for various licenses, permits and registrations.

Using smartform technology, users can complete application forms and submit them either online or via traditional means, speeding up the application process.

The forms are dynamic, enabling the fields to change depending on the information completed and when users fill out fields with their details, the information is remembered for future use.

EasyBiz Latest News
Standard Business Reporting
The Federal Government has recently announced a Standard Business Reporting (SBR) project. The aim of the project is to standardise the data reporting requirements of regulatory authorities. The outcomes of this project will be reduced effort by business in compliance/reporting to government as data will be reused and redistributed (e.g. pre-fill forms with permission). With SBR, small business will inform/report to Government once, and have this common data (e.g. name, address, ABN, company profile) reused across tiers of government and perhaps even the private sector (banks, utilities, etc). The EasyBiz project will aim to adopt SBR and will implement architectures and standards that are consistent with SBR.
